The Augustusplatz 9 office building is part of the City Tower, one of Leipzig's most distinctive landmarks and, at around 142.5 meters, the tallest building in the city. The skyscraper was built in 1972 according to plans by renowned architect Hermann Henselmann and is an impressive example of modern high-rise architecture in the GDR.

Augustusplatz 9 is centrally located in the city center of Leipzig, right next to the city skyscraper. Augustusplatz is one of the city's most important transport hubs and offers excellent public transport connections. The Leipzig Markt S-Bahn station with lines S1 to S6 is just a few minutes' walk away, and numerous tram and bus lines also run directly on the square.
The environment is characterized by gastronomy, retail, cultural institutions and urban life. The central location, short distances and lively surroundings make the location particularly attractive for modern office tenants.
